Program Analysis

First-year earnings of $32,171 track close to the $31,622 national median for Medical Assisting programs. This is a middle-of-the-road outcome on salary alone.

The 88.8x earnings multiple means ten-year projected earnings exceed tuition cost by an order of magnitude. Trade programs often deliver strong ratios, and this one is a standout.

AI risk is moderate — 28% task exposure — and the 7% scenario spread suggests disruption would dent but not destroy the earnings outlook for Medical Assisting graduates.

Ranked #129 out of 1,065 programs, Grand Rapids Community College's Medical Assisting program lands in the top 5% — a strong signal of graduate success.

Earnings growth is modest: $32,171 to $35,622 over five years (11% gain). This trade may have a lower salary ceiling than high-growth professions.

With 11 registered apprenticeships mapped to Medical Assisting, graduates have substantial options for hands-on training paths that pay from day one.
